From a6f1bf29aed0e041fa7e0c884d6166b4564a3908 Mon Sep 17 00:00:00 2001 From: Florian Bruhin Date: Mon, 20 Oct 2014 12:01:48 +0200 Subject: [PATCH] Revert "Remove unneeded invalidateFilter call." This reverts commit b5781f0ed3ad2fdd517afa37f7845919aa319c99. For some reason this did break the "completion->shrink" setting. Closes #204. Makes #190 a bit worse again though. Conflicts: qutebrowser/models/completionfilter.py --- qutebrowser/models/completionfilter.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/qutebrowser/models/completionfilter.py b/qutebrowser/models/completionfilter.py index 8243c2752..df26ad97b 100644 --- a/qutebrowser/models/completionfilter.py +++ b/qutebrowser/models/completionfilter.py @@ -58,12 +58,13 @@ class CompletionFilterModel(QSortFilterProxyModel): val: The value to set. """ self.pattern = val - self.invalidate() + self.invalidateFilter() sortcol = 0 try: self.srcmodel.sort(sortcol) except NotImplementedError: self.sort(sortcol) + self.invalidate() def count(self): """Get the count of non-toplevel items currently visible.